Brockworth Primary Academy is a two form entry primary school on an ambitious journey to make a real difference to the lives of our children. We are proud to be a part of Academies Enterprise Trust, a collaborative educational organisation striving for excellence across all 57 of our remarkable schools.
Brockworth has large spacious classrooms, fantastic grounds, two halls, chromebooks and iPads for every class, an academy library, excellent resources for the curriculum and our very own technology workshop, which includes a large kitchen.
As a growing academy, which serves Brockworth, we have a strong, supportive team of staff, who are well supported by expertise across the Trust to help realise the next steps of their careers.

Commitment to safeguarding
Lift Schools are committed to ensuring the highest levels of safeguarding and promoting the welfare of our pupils, and we expect all our people and volunteers to share this commitment. We adopt a fair and consistent recruitment process which is inline with Keeping Children Safe in Education guidance. This includes online checks for shortlisted candidates. All offers of employment are subject to an Enhanced DBS check, references, and where applicable, a prohibition from teaching check.
